Formular mit mehreren Unterformularen erstellen

17/09/2007 - 14:55 von kawaletz | Report spam
Hallo Spezis,

ich habe ein ziemlich heftiges Problem 3 Tabellen in einem Formular
miteinander zu verknüpfen.
Tabelle 1: ,,tblMitarbeiter" mit ,,idMitarbeiter"
Tabelle 2: ,,tblTelefonate" mit ,,idMitarbeiter" und ,,idTelefonat"
Tabelle 3: ,,tblInhaltTelefonat" mit ,,idMitarbeiter" und ,,idTelefonat"

Im Formular ,,frmHaupt" soll ein Mitarbeiterdatensatz in der
Einspaltigen Ansicht dargestellt werden. Dazu soll als
Datenblattansicht angezeigt werden, welche Gespràche er geführt hat.
In Abhàngigkeit, welcher Datensatz aus der Datenblattansicht
,,frmSubTelefonate" gerade aktuell ist, soll in einer Einspaltigen
Ansicht der Inhalt per Checkbox angeklickt werden können.

Das Hautpformular ,,frmHaupt" hat also zwei Unterformulare
,,frmSubTelefonate" und ,,frmSubInhaltTel". Dabei habe ich es geschafft
mit dem Assistenten die Zuordnung zwischen ,,frmHaupt" und
,,frmSubTelefonate" richtig herzustellen. Die Zuordnung zwischen
,,frmSubTelefonate" und ,,frmSubInhaltTel" will mir aber nicht gelingen,
weil ,,frmSubInhaltTel" kein Subformular von ,,frmSubTelefonate" ist.
Ich nehme an, dass es irgendwie über die Feldeigenschaften
,,Datenherkunft" mittels der ,,idTelefonat" und der ,,idMitarbeiter"
funktionieren müsste. Bisher waren meine Bemühungen aber vergebens.
Wenn ich ,,frmSubInhaltTel" als Unterformular von ,,frmSubTelefonate"
mit dem Assistenten erstellen lasse, dann habe ich beides als
Datenblattansicht in einer Tabelle und das soll es nicht sein. Die
Beziehungen sind richtig gesetzt, da ich die Daten in der
Datenblattansicht schon eingepflegt habe.
Gibt es einen einfachen Weg (ohne zu programmieren) diese Verbingung
im Formular herzustellen?
 

Lesen sie die antworten

#1 Jens Schilling
17/09/2007 - 16:09 | Warnen spam
Hallo,

wrote:
Hallo Spezis,

ich habe ein ziemlich heftiges Problem 3 Tabellen in einem Formular
miteinander zu verknüpfen.
Tabelle 1: ,,tblMitarbeiter" mit ,,idMitarbeiter"
Tabelle 2: ,,tblTelefonate" mit ,,idMitarbeiter" und ,,idTelefonat"
Tabelle 3: ,,tblInhaltTelefonat" mit ,,idMitarbeiter" und
,,idTelefonat"

Im Formular ,,frmHaupt" soll ein Mitarbeiterdatensatz in der
Einspaltigen Ansicht dargestellt werden. Dazu soll als
Datenblattansicht angezeigt werden, welche Gespràche er geführt hat.
In Abhàngigkeit, welcher Datensatz aus der Datenblattansicht
,,frmSubTelefonate" gerade aktuell ist, soll in einer Einspaltigen
Ansicht der Inhalt per Checkbox angeklickt werden können.

Das Hautpformular ,,frmHaupt" hat also zwei Unterformulare
,,frmSubTelefonate" und ,,frmSubInhaltTel". Dabei habe ich es
geschafft mit dem Assistenten die Zuordnung zwischen ,,frmHaupt" und
,,frmSubTelefonate" richtig herzustellen. Die Zuordnung zwischen
,,frmSubTelefonate" und ,,frmSubInhaltTel" will mir aber nicht
gelingen, weil ,,frmSubInhaltTel" kein Subformular von
,,frmSubTelefonate" ist. Ich nehme an, dass es irgendwie über die
Feldeigenschaften ,,Datenherkunft" mittels der ,,idTelefonat" und der
,,idMitarbeiter" funktionieren müsste. Bisher waren meine Bemühungen
aber vergebens. Wenn ich ,,frmSubInhaltTel" als Unterformular von
,,frmSubTelefonate" mit dem Assistenten erstellen lasse, dann habe
ich beides als Datenblattansicht in einer Tabelle und das soll es
nicht sein. Die Beziehungen sind richtig gesetzt, da ich die Daten in
der Datenblattansicht schon eingepflegt habe.
Gibt es einen einfachen Weg (ohne zu programmieren) diese Verbingung
im Formular herzustellen?



Wen ich Dich denn richtig verstanden habe, könntest Du es über den hier
geschilderten Weg einmal versuchen :

http://groups.google.com/group/micr...e&Ganz ohne Code geht es zwar nicht, aber--GrussJens______________________________FAQ: http://www.donkarl.com10. Access-Entwickler-Konferenz (AEK)Nürnberg 6./7.10.2007 und 20./21.10.2007http://www.donkarl.com/?AEK

Ähnliche fragen